Why is knurling done?

It is used to provide a gripping surface, change the appearance of the work, or increase the work's diameter.

A(n) ____ type chuck is normally fitted in the tailstock for drilling.

Jacobs

What is the first step that should be performed before using a lathe?

The machine should be inspected for safe and proper operation.

What do long stringy chips indicate?

The tool is not properly sharpened.

Cutting speed and feed govern what conditions?

They determine the length of time required to machine a job and the quality of the surface finish.

A__ chuck can hold irregular shape work as each jaw has individual movement

4-jaw independent

What cutting speed is recommended when reaming on the lathe?

About two-thirds the speed used for a similar size drill.

What is a mandrel?

An accurately made cylindrical section of hardened steel that has been ground with a slight taper.

When parting material, how should the work be mounted in a chuck?

As close to the chuck as possible.

____ indicates the distance the work moves past the cutting tool per minute.

Cutting speed

____ is the distance the cutter moves longitudinally along the ways during a single revolution of the work.

Feed

How is a steady rest used?

It is bolted directly to the lathe ways and provides additional support for long, thin work pieces.

____ cuts are made to reduce work diameter to approximate size.

Roughing

What is the most accurate method for centering round stock in a 4-jaw chuck?

Using a dial indicator.
